The flags in front of Victoria Police headquarters have been lowered in tribute to the Metropolitan Police officer killed in the terrorist attack in London on Wednesday. 

PC Keith Palmer was stabbed by the lone suspect in the attack outside the Houses of Parliament.

The husband and father with 15 years’ service later died from his injuries.

“Our flags are at half-mast to honour fallen officer Keith Palmer & the other victims in London.” reads a social media message from VicPD.

The Metropolitan Police federation paid tribute to 48-year old PC Palmer “Our brave Met colleague who today made the ultimate sacrifice
